#slide-out{width:240px !important}body{position:initial !important;font-family:"Roboto";color:initial}h1,h2,h3,h4,h5,h6,a,p,ul li,strong,b,i,input,input[value],input[placeholder],select,label,button{font-family:"Roboto" !important;color:initial}a:hover{text-decoration:none}h1{font-size:2.8rem;color:#555;margin:.2rem 0 0 0;font-weight:500}h1 span{font-weight:300 !important}h2{font-size:2.0rem;font-weight:500;letter-spacing:.04em}h3{font-size:1.8rem !important;color:#0f0 font-weight:300;letter-spacing:.04em}h3.form-title{margin:1.46rem 0 0 0}ul{margin:0}.msp-styles{background:#f3f3f3}.msp-styles .container{max-width:100%;width:96%}.msp-styles #main-header{text-align:center}.msp-styles #main-header h1{font-size:1.5rem;font-weight:300;letter-spacing:.04em}.msp-styles .msp-header{text-align:right;font-size:2rem;margin:2.1rem 15% 1.68rem 0}.msp-style.header h1{margin-bottom:.6rem}.msp-styles #main-header h1 .bulls{margin:0 15px}.msp-styles .msp-header-image{width:100%}.msp-styles #menu{text-align:left}.msp-styles #menu .hamburger-icon{display:block;max-width:33px;position:relative;margin:2.1rem 0 1.68rem 0;font-size:12px}.msp-styles #menu .hamburger-icon span{width:33px;margin:auto;height:3px;background:#000;display:block;margin-top:3px}.msp-styles.this_white #menu .hamburger-icon span{background:#fff}.msp-styles.this_black #menu .hamburger-icon span{background:#000}.msp-styles #menu .hamburger-icon span:nth-child(3){margin-bottom:4px}.msp-styles #blog-link{text-align:right}.msp-styles #blog-link a{display:block;color:#000;font-size:1.5rem;font-weight:300;margin:2.1rem 0 1.68rem 0}.msp-styles .container.standard-header{max-width:100%;width:100%;padding:0 2%;border-bottom:1px solid #dcdcdc;background:#fff}.msp-styles .container.standard-header #main-navigation{margin-bottom:0}.msp-styles .standard-header .hamburger-icon{display:inline-block !important}.msp-styles .standard-header h1{font-size:1rem}.msp-styles.this_white #blog-link a,.msp-styles.this_white #main-header h1,.msp-styles.this_white h2,.msp-styles.this_white #menu .hamburger-icon{color:#fff}.msp-styles.this_black #blog-link a,.msp-styles.this_black #main-header h1,.msp-styles.this_black h2,.msp-styles.this_black #menu .hamburger-icon{color:#000}@media screen and (min-width:600px){.msp-left-col,.msp-right-col{display:inline-block;width:30%;vertical-align:top}.msp-left-col{margin:0 10% 0 10%}.msp-center-col{display:block;margin:35px auto 0;width:560px}.msp-left-col.header{margin-bottom:.6rem}}.msp-styles footer.page-footer{position:fixed;bottom:0;width:100%;padding:0;background:transparent}.msp-styles footer.page-footer .footer-copyright{color:#000;background-color:transparent !important}.msp-styles .slider.fullscreen{position:absolute;z-index:-1}.msp-styles .carousel.carousel-slider{margin-left:2%;width:98%;height:auto}.msp-styles .carousel.carousel-slider .carousel-item{width:50%;padding:5px}.msp-styles .gallery-navigation{margin:68px 0 68px 2%}.msp-styles .gallery-navigation .btn-msp{font-size:24px;color:#000;font-weight:300;border-radius:3px;border:1px solid #000;padding:5px 12px;margin:0 20px 0 0;cursor:pointer}.msp-styles .gallery-navigation strong,.msp-styles .gallery-navigation span{font-size:22px;margin:0 6px}.msp-styles .gallery-navigation span{font-size:18px}.msp-styles .carousel .img-enclosure{display:block!}.msp-styles .carousel-item h3{font-size:24px;font-weight:400;color:#000;margin-bottom:0}.msp-styles .carousel-item p{color:#000;font-weight:300;font-size:18px}.msp-styles .carousel-item p.date{margin-top:0}.msp-styles .photo-counter{margin:0}.msp-styles .lightbox{display:none;width:100%;height:100%;background:rgba(0,0,0,0.85);top:0;bottom:0;left:0;right:0;position:absolute}.msp-styles .closer{position:absolute;right:30px;top:30px;background-image:url("//cdn2.hubspot.net/hubfs/163745/test_contents/carousel-arrow.png");background-size:46px;width:46px;height:46px;background-position:-25px;cursor:pointer}.msp-styles .lightbox [class*="arrow-"]{position:absolute;top:50%;margin-top:-50px;background-image:url("//cdn2.hubspot.net/hubfs/163745/test_contents/carousel-arrow.png") !important;background-size:100px;width:50px;height:100px;background-position:-50px;cursor:pointer}.msp-styles .lightbox .arrow-left{left:20px;background-position:0 0}.msp-styles .lightbox .arrow-right{right:20px}.msp-styles .lightbox .image-container{max-height:90%;max-width:90%;margin:auto;position:absolute;top:30px;right:30px;bottom:30px;left:30px}.msp-styles .lightbox .image-container img{width:100%;max-width:80%;margin:auto;position:absolute;left:0;right:0;top:0;bottom:0}@media screen and (min-width:1024px){.msp-styles .carousel.carousel-slider .carousel-item{width:33.33%;padding:5px}}@media screen and (max-width:600px){.msp-styles .carousel.carousel-slider .carousel-item{width:100%;padding:0px;overflow-y:scroll}.msp-styles .carousel.carousel-slider .carousel-item h3,.msp-styles .carousel.carousel-slider .carousel-item .date,.msp-styles .carousel.carousel-slider .carousel-item .brief-desc,#menu{padding:0 24px}.msp-styles .carousel.carousel-slider{margin:0;width:100%}#main-header,#blog-link,.next,.prev{display:none}.msp-styles .gallery-navigation{margin:38px 0 38px 2%}}.home #main-navigation{position:relative;z-index:99}.msp-styles .gallery-navigation .btn-msp{font-size:20px}#slide-gallery{top:92px}}.edge_to_edge{display:block;width:100%;margin-top:50px !important;min-height:520px}.edge_to_edge:before .edge_to_edge:after{display:table;content:".";zoom:1;clear:both;width:100%;height:1px}.edge_to_edge [class*='row_']>div{height:260px;position:relative;border-right:2px solid #f3f3f3;border-left:2px solid #f3f3f3;border-bottom:4px solid #f3f3f3;display:inline-block;overflow:hidden;float:left;box-sizing:border-box;cursor:pointer;background-size:cover;background-position:center center}.edge_to_edge .row_1>div{width:100%}.edge_to_edge .row_2>div{width:50%}.edge_to_edge .row_3>div{width:33.333%}.edge_to_edge .row_4>div{width:25%}.edge_to_edge .row_5>div{width:20%}.edge_to_edge .row_6>div{width:16.666%}form label{color:#000;margin:10px 0 0 0}form label span{color:#000;font-size:1rem}.hs_cos_wrapper.form-title{margin-bottom:15px}